JDBCMailRepository contains several examples of exception handing similar to:
} catch (Exception me) {
throw new MessagingException("Exception while retrieving
mail: " + me.getMessage());
}
the downside with this approach is that information about the original
exception (including the stack trace) are lost. (i'm getting a null
pointer thrown but without a stack trace it's hard to know where the
problem lies.)
any reason why changing these to:
} catch (Exception me) {
getLogger().debug("XXX", me);
throw new MessagingException("Exception while retrieving mail: " +
me.getMessage(), me);
}
would be a bad idea?
